Seeing Double

It’s not often that the same Pattern plays across two lotteries at once! Both Lotto Texas and Powerball saw the same Pattern on March 10, 2018. But, due to the nature of each lottery, this was where all similarities ended. Our analysis showed them going onto wildly divergent paths.

Lotto Texas

General Lottery Analysis

The {3-2-1} Pattern, with winning numbers 5, 15, 27, 32, 36, and 46, has now played 796 times.

The first {3-2-1} Pattern of the night. Source: lotterytrend.com.

Given that there have been 1532 Lotto Texas drawings, this Pattern has played in about 52% of them. Prior to Saturday night, this {3-2-1} Pattern was seen on February 21, 2018.

Now with 130 appearances, the 2 3 1 Specific Order has played in 16.3% of the 796 drawings where {3-2-1} was the winning Pattern. This Specific Order has also played in 8.49% of all 1532 drawings and was last seen at the beginning of the year. More specifically, the January 3, 2018 drawing.

Four-Number Combination(s)

There were also two repeating Four-Number Combinations:

  • 15, 27, 36, 46 (Debuted May 8, 2002)
  • 5, 15, 27, 36 (Debuted March 22, 2017)
From the “distant” past to the recent past. Source: lotterytrend.com.

The {3-2-1} Pattern is the most commonly seen Pattern in Lotto Texas. This isn’t the case in Powerball.

Powerball

General Lottery Analysis

Unlike Lotto Texas, the {3-2-1} Pattern in Powerball is one of the least commonly seen Patterns. Its 16th appearance was thanks to winning numbers 43, 44, 54, 61, 69, and PB 22.

The *other* {3-2-1} Pattern. Source: lotterytrend-powerball.com.

Out of the 254 Powerball drawings, this {3-2-1} Pattern has played in 6.30% of them and was last seen on February 3, 2018.

The [3-2-1] General Order made its 6th appearance and has played in 37.5% of the 16 drawings where {3-2-1} was the winning Pattern. This General Order has also played in 2.36% of all 254 drawings. Like the {3-2-1} Pattern, this General Order was also last seen in the February 3rd drawing.

One highlight of the evening was the debut of the 0 0 0 3 2 1 Specific Order. This General Order has played in roughly 16.7% of the six drawings where the General Order was [3-2-1], and in 6.25% of the 16 drawings where {3-2-1} was the winning Pattern. This Specific Order has played in 0.39% of all 254 drawings.

Three-Number Combination(s)

The lone repeating Three-Number Combination of the evening was 54, 61, PB 22.

One (repeating) Three-Number Combination to rule them all. Source: lotterytrend-powerball.com.

This Combination made its debut in the December 30, 2015 drawing.
